A Watermark Algorithm with Constant Robustness and Trellis Codes
|
Abstract:
In this paper,a new trellis coded watermarking algorithm of trellis codes combine with constant robustness embedding is proposed. In the algorithm,both informed coding and informed embedding are used. The watermark is encoded by a dirty-paper trellis encoder. Then the strength of the noise to be added to reduce the normalized correlation coefficient to a given threshold is computed,which is taken as a constant robustness parameter. The watermark signal is embedded into the cover work by Gram-Schmidt orthogonal algorithm under the condition of the constant robustness parameter,and Viterbi algorithm is used to detect and extract the watermarked signal. Experimental results indicate that the proposed algorithm can improve the robustness to white Gaussian noise and amplitude scaling.
